Lion is set in Australia and India and is based on the true story and book A Long Way Home by Saroo.
In the film Nicole and David Wenham play a Tasmanian couple who adopt Saroo from an orphanage in India.
Then 25 years later, Saroo - now played by Dev - tries to find his birth family using Google Earth and Facebook.
The film is set to be released November 25.
